The Christ Day in Iraq, Friday November 18th, went very well, actually much better than expected. Though it is in Arabic, you can watch a small report here to get an idea of what a triumph it was to get so many from different Christian traditions together along with many refugees and others from non-Christian backgrounds. http://m.youtube.com/watch?v=CpVVJ6Dbkis. One of the organizers describes what happened:
“We had two types of meetings, a small one on Thursday for believers, and a big one on Friday for everyone. The second one was attended by very few believers and majority of nonbelievers.
Saying all that, the Lord did not leave us without a blessing/surprise! A Christian singer from another background, gave a very bold simple message about giving ourselves to the Will of God. He led all the audience to pray with him, surrendering their lives to the Will of God through Jesus Christ, and then sang a beautiful song about "the Lord is near to all those who call upon Him”.
It was just marvelous, seeing everyone bowing down and praying that prayer, including many nuns and a couple of priests together with all the audience, praise the Lord.
As we were planning, Christ Day is not just an event but a start of a new era of the Iraqi Church. The Lord showed us that there were many young people very much touched by what was going on. He showed us a need to start a youth ministry among them!
